    Ok, I've got to ask this. In the AMON panal in the control center, it lists the number of files scanned, infected, cleaned, the version. Under file name it has CookieLog.txt. What is CookieLog.txt?

    That field shows the last file that AMON scanned. Some other program is using that file, so it gets scanned by AMON, and shown in the AMON window.
